2023-10-17Move i.MX8 container image loading support to common/splSean Anderson
To facilitate testing loading i.MX8 container images, move the parse-container code to common/spl. Signed-off-by: Sean Anderson <[email protected]>
2023-10-17arm: imx: Check header before calling spl_load_imx_containerSean Anderson
Make sure we have an IMX header before calling spl_load_imx_container, since if we don't it will fail with -ENOENT. This allows us to fall back to legacy/raw images if they are also enabled. This is a functional change, one which likely should have been in place from the start, but a functional change nonetheless. Previously, all non-IMX8 images (except FITs without FIT_FULL) would be optimized out if the only image load method enabled supported IMX8 images. With this change, support for other image types now has an effect. There are seven boards with SPL_LOAD_IMX_CONTAINER enabled: three with SPL_BOOTROM_SUPPORT: imx93_11x11_evk_ld imx93_11x11_evk imx8ulp_evk and four with SPL_MMC: deneb imx8qxp_mek giedi imx8qm_mek All of these boards also have SPL_RAW_IMAGE_SUPPORT and SPL_LEGACY_IMAGE_FORMAT enabled as well. However, none have FIT support enabled. Of the six load methods affected by this patch, only SPL_MMC and SPL_BOOTROM_SUPPORT are enabled with SPL_LOAD_IMX_CONTAINER. spl_romapi_load_image_seekable does not support legacy or raw images, so there is no growth. However, mmc_load_image_raw_sector does support loading legacy/raw images. Since these images could not have been booted before, I have disabled support for legacy/raw images on these four boards. This reduces bloat from around 800 bytes to around 200. There are no in-tree boards with SPL_LOAD_IMX_CONTAINER and AHAB_BOOT both enabled, so we do not need to worry about potentially falling back to legacy images in a secure boot scenario. Future work could include merging imx_container.h with imx8image.h, since they appear to define mostly the same structures. Signed-off-by: Sean Anderson <[email protected]>

2023-10-17Revert "fs: ext4: check the minimal partition size to mount"Sean Anderson
This check breaks small partitions (under 1024 blocks) because part_length is in units of part.blksz and not bytes. Given the purpose of this function, we really want to make sure the partition is SUPERBLOCK_START + SUPERBLOCK_SIZE (2048) bytes so we can call ext4_read_superblock without error. The obvious solution is to convert callers from things like ext4fs_mount(part_info.size) to ext4fs_mount(part_info.size * part_info.blksz); However, I'm not really a fan of the bloat that would cause, especially since the error is now suppressed. I think the best course of action here is to just revert the patch. This reverts commit 9905cae65e03335aefcb1ebfab5b7ee62d89f64e. 2023-10-17ARM: imx: Use correct U-Boot offset in case of secondary boot from eMMCFedor Ross
In case of a secondary image boot from the user area of an eMMC device, the correct offset must be calculated. The offset is fused in the fuse IMG_CNTN_SET1_OFFSET of the i.MX8M Nano and Plus. The calculation of the offset is described in the reference manual (IMX8MNRM Rev. 2, 07/2022 and IMX8MPRM Rev. 1, 06/2021): The fuse IMG_CNTN_SET1_OFFSET (0x490[22:19]) is defined as follows: * Secondary boot is disabled if fuse value is bigger than 10, n = fuse value bigger than 10. * n == 0: Offset = 4MB * n == 2: Offset = 1MB * Others & n <= 10 : Offset = 1MB*2^n Signed-off-by: Fedor Ross <[email protected]> Signed-off-by: Marek Vasut <[email protected]>

2023-10-17arm: rmobile: Support RZ/G2L memory mapPaul Barker
The memory map for the RZ/G2L family differs from that of previous R-Car Gen3/Gen4 SoCs. A high level memory map can be seen in figure 5.2 (section 5.2.1) of the RZ/G2L data sheet rev 1.30 published May 12, 2023. A summary is included here (note that this is a 34-bit address space): * 0x0_0000_0000 - 0x0_0002_FFFF SRAM area * 0x0_0003_0000 - 0x0_0FFF_FFFF Reserved area * 0x0_1000_0000 - 0x0_1FFF_FFFF I/O register area * 0x0_2000_0000 - 0x0_2FFF_FFFF SPI Multi area * 0x0_3000_0000 - 0x0_3FFF_FFFF Reserved area * 0x0_4000_0000 - 0x1_3FFF_FFFF DDR area (4 GiB) * 0x1_4000_0000 - 0x3_FFFF_FFFF Reserved area Within the DDR area, the first 128 MiB are reserved by TrustedFirmware. The region from 0x43F00000 to 0x47DFFFFF inclusive is protected for use in TrustedFirmware/OP-TEE, but all other memory is included in the memory map. This reservation is the same as used in R-Car Gen3/Gen4 and RZ/G2{H,M,N,E} SoCs. DRAM information is initialised based on the data in the fdt. 2023-10-17arm: rmobile: Add CPU detection for RZ/G2LPaul Barker
The ARM TrustedFirmware code for the Renesas RZ/G2L SoC family passes a devicetree blob to the bootloader as an argument in the same was previous R-Car Gen3/Gen4 SoCs. This blob contains a compatible string which can be used to identify the particular SoC we are running on. We do this as reading the DEVID & PRR registers from u-boot is not sufficient to differentiate between the R9A07G044L (RZ/G2L) and R9A07G044C (RZ/G2LC) SoCs. An additional read from offset 0x11861178 is needed but this address is in the OTP region which can only be read from the secure world (i.e. TrustedFirmware). So we have to rely on TrustedFirmware to determine the SoC and pass this information to u-boot via an fdt blob.
